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u said Israel will not leave the attack on the Golan Heights unanswered. This was reported by TASS According to the statement made by the Prime Ministry. According to the latest data, 11 people, including young people and children, died and 19 people were injured as a result of the missile attack.
“Hezbollah will pay the highest price for this that it has never paid before,” Netanyahu’s press service said.
The Israeli Prime Minister stressed that he was shocked by the loss of innocent people, including children. He expressed his heartfelt condolences to the families who lost their loved ones.

The situation in the Middle East escalated further on October 7, 2023, when thousands of armed militants from the radical Palestinian movement Hamas entered Israel from the Gaza Strip, attacking civilians and kidnapping more than 200 hostages. In response,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u declared the country at war. A ground operation was launched, aimed at returning the hostages and completely destroying Hamas.
